中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

sql have與where的區別是什么

sql
小樊
82
2024-07-31 11:14:10
欄目: 云計算

SQL中的HAVINGWHERE都是用來過濾數據的關鍵字,但它們之間有一些區別:

  1. WHERE是在查詢中使用的條件過濾器,通常用于對行進行過濾。它在數據分組前對行進行篩選。 HAVING是在GROUP BY子句中使用的條件過濾器,通常用于對分組后的結果進行過濾。它在數據分組后對行進行篩選。

  2. WHERE子句在SELECT語句中出現的位置在GROUP BY子句之前,而HAVING子句在SELECT語句中出現的位置在GROUP BY子句之后。

  3. HAVING通常是在對數據進行聚合運算后對結果進行過濾,而WHERE通常是在對數據行進行過濾。

總的來說,WHEREHAVING都是用來篩選數據的關鍵字,但它們的使用場景和作用略有不同。WHERE用于在數據分組前對行進行篩選,而HAVING用于在數據分組后對結果進行篩選。

0
德钦县| 淳安县| 宁安市| 荔波县| 长乐市| 汤原县| 栖霞市| 汶上县| 玛曲县| 定安县| 津市市| 武夷山市| 贡山| 禹州市| 湘西| 新干县| 涿州市| 讷河市| 英山县| 外汇| 阿荣旗| 大方县| 昔阳县| 黄浦区| 武城县| 鹤峰县| 长泰县| 常山县| 阜平县| 卓尼县| 揭阳市| 鸡东县| 临西县| 田林县| 镇江市| 静海县| 大兴区| 翁源县| 仙居县| 腾冲县| 长岭县|